Significant differences between shrimp and almond oil

  • The amount of copper, phosphorus, zinc, magnesium, potassium, calcium, and iron in shrimp is higher than in almond oil.
  • Shrimp covers your daily cholesterol needs 63% more than almond oil.
  • Almond oil contains less cholesterol.

Specific food types used in this comparison are Crustaceans, shrimp, cooked (not previously frozen) and Oil, almond.
